Job Description:
We are looking for a highly skilled Full Stack Developer with hands-on experience in React.Js, Java, and Spring Boot to design, develop, and implement scalable web applications.
The ideal candidate will have a strong understanding of front-end and back-end technologies, RESTful API development, and cloud deployment best practices.
Key Responsibilities:
- Develop and maintain full-stack web applications using React (frontend) and Java/Spring Boot (backend).
- Design and build RESTful APIs and integrate with external systems.
- Collaborate with UI/UX designers, backend developers, and QA engineers to deliver end-to-end solutions.
- Optimize application performance, scalability, and responsiveness.
- Write clean, maintainable, and testable code following best practices.
- Participate in code reviews, Agile ceremonies, and CI/CD pipeline processes.
- Troubleshoot and debug applications across environments.
Required Skills & Experience:
- 5+ years of experience as a Full Stack Developer or similar role.
- Strong proficiency in React.Js, Java, and Spring Boot.
- Experience with REST API design, Microservices architecture, and JSON/XML.
- Hands-on experience with SQL/NoSQL databases (e.G., MySQL, PostgreSQL, MongoDB).
- Familiarity with CI/CD tools (Jenkins, Git, Docker, Kubernetes preferred).
- Solid understanding of HTML5, CSS3, and JavaScript (ES6+).
- Knowledge of cloud platforms (AWS, Azure, or GCP) is a plus.
- Excellent problem-solving and communication skills.